Antipa Minerals' Minyari Dome drilling reveals promising gold discoveries

Antipa Minerals Ltd (ASX:AZY) managing director Roger Mason joins Jonathan Jackson in the Proactive studio to discuss positive final results from its 2024 Phase 1 reverse circulation (RC) drilling program at the Minyari Dome Gold-Copper Project in Western Australia. The program, initially set for 74 drill holes, expanded to 81 due to favourable early outcomes. Drilling unveiled new zones of near-surface, high-grade gold, especially at the northern edge of the GEO-01 discovery, the GP01 target, and the Minyari Southeastern Extension target. The GEO-01 discovery now has a mineralised footprint of 700 metres by 500 metres, with key intersections indicating substantial resource potential. Results suggest extensive potential for a maiden resource, with mineralisation at multiple GEO-01 lodes and the Minyari Southeast Extension target remaining open. Antipa plans to explore these areas further in the 2024 Phase 2 drilling program to enhance the 1.8-million-ounce gold resource at Minyari Dome, aiming for significant resource expansion. Managing director Roger Mason highlighted the successful identification of new gold zones, enhancing the resource potential and generating new drill targets.
